Failures in Child-Protection Services: An Inadequate Approach to Listening

The rare assessments of the French protective system for children show that the results concerning the emotional and intellectual state of the children in custody are poor. One of the reasons of this failure is the lack of a setting allowing for an individual listening of the children. The causes for this state of affairs are described, as are the characteristics of a suitable listening-work with the child: continuity, duration, discretion, supervision. Only this kind of work is able to counterbalance the feelings of a child confronted with very inadequate parents: idealization, sticking to the inadequate parent, seduction, awe. A detailed clinical exemple illustrates these principles.
